Halaman ini memberikan ringkasan tentang cara dan waktu untuk mengonfigurasi skema di penyimpanan HL7v2 untuk mengurai pesan HL7v2.
Skema default
Cloud Healthcare API menggunakan skema default untuk mengurai pesan HL7v2 yang sesuai dengan standar HL7v2. Jika pesan HL7v2 Anda sesuai dengan standar, dan tidak berisi segmen, kolom, atau data kustom lain yang menyimpang dari standar, lihat Mengaktifkan penguraian berskema untuk pesan HL7v2.
Skema khusus
Jika Anda memiliki pesan HL7v2 yang tidak sesuai dengan standar HL7v2, lihat Menggunakan skema kustom untuk mengurai pesan HL7v2.
Memilih versi parser
Anda dapat menentukan opsi untuk parser di objek ParserConfig
, terlepas dari apakah Anda menggunakan
skema default atau skema kustom. ParserConfig
berisi objek
ParserVersion
yang memungkinkan Anda menentukan versi untuk parser. Lihat dokumentasi referensi untuk mengetahui detail tentang setiap versi.
Sebaiknya, untuk semua kasus penggunaan, tentukan
versi
V3
parser. Versi V3
memiliki keuntungan berikut:
- Class ini berisi fungsi yang ada di versi
V2
. Saat digunakan dengan parser default, parser akan meng-escape karakter kontrol HL7v2 default yang di-escape:
- Pemisah kolom:
|
- Pemisah komponen:
^
- Pemisah sub-komponen:
&
- Pemisah pengulangan:
~
- Karakter escape:
\
- Karakter pemotongan:
#
- Pemisah kolom:
Saat digunakan dengan parser kustom, parser
V3
menggunakan teknik pencocokan yang lebih baik dibandingkan versi parser lainnya.